Federal Prosecutors Discuss SamSam Indictments

In the latest edition of the ISMG Security Report, hear prosecutors discuss the indictments of two Iranians in connection with SamSam ransomware attacks.

In this report, you'll hear (click on player beneath image to listen):

  • Executive Editor Mathew Schwartz's report on the indictments tied to SamSam, featuring comments from two prosecutors and an FBI official;
  • Managing Editor Jeremy Kirk explain why consumer groups are alleging that Google is violating the EU's General Data Protection Regulation;
  • Juniper Network's Laurence Pitt discuss the impact of cryptocurrency technologies on cybercrime.
